Ssense

Ssense is a fashion-forward retailer that sells footwear, clothing, and accessories from top designers and brands. The items offered on the site are authentic and they have been inspected to ensure the highest quality. The company offers a dedicated customer service team to assist shoppers with any questions or issues.

The inventory of the site comes directly from designer brands and boutiques which gives Ssense more buying power and allows them to provide lower prices than other retailers. Ssense offers free shipping on orders over $100 and has flexible return policies.

Ssense is a well-known online store for educated and well-dressed millennials. more than 80percent of its customers between the age of 18 and 34. It aims to make high-end fashion more accessible to the millennial market by combining established brands such as Alexander McQueen, Balenciaga and Interior with new and emerging labels like Connor Ives.

Rotaro

Established in the year 2019, Rotaro is a fashion rental service that lets its customers rent dresses, tops, bottoms, and bags instead of buying them. The company hopes to reduce waste in the world through the reduction of the amount of people who purchase clothing for a single use. They also offer a subscription service that includes delivery, laundering and insurance.

River Island

With stylish and affordable styles, River Island allows customers to buy everything they need for a complete look from head-to-toe. There are a variety of styles to select from, and they provide matching shoes and bags. They're the perfect one-stop shop for any occasion. They aim to be as green as possible and have long-term relationships with their suppliers as well as their employees.

With 350 stores and an international online business, River Island puts social content front-and-center to inspire shoppers from all over the world. Its brand-name Galleries contain user-generated videos as well as images, which allow customers to imagine their style through the products. Galleries result in an 184% increase in conversions and a 45% increase in the average order value of those who shop. The brand also uses Bazaarvoice's Gallery to allow customers to add specific items they see in Galleries to their wish list which increases conversion even more.
